Checklist for Managing Demand Fluctuations

Checklist for Managing Demand Fluctuations

Demand fluctuations can make or break your eCommerce business. Whether it's a holiday surge or an unexpected sales drop, failing to manage inventory and cash flow effectively can lead to lost revenue, excess stock, or even damaged marketplace rankings. Here's how to stay ahead:

  • Analyze demand patterns: Use sales history to spot seasonal trends and external factors like weather or promotions that affect demand.
  • Segment products: Focus on high-margin, high-demand items while minimizing risks for slow-moving SKUs.
  • Plan for scenarios: Prepare for base, surge, and drop scenarios to align inventory and financing with potential outcomes.
  • Diversify suppliers: Work with multiple suppliers and shorten lead times to reduce delays and risks.
  • Optimize fulfillment: Use 3PLs and marketplace services to ensure timely deliveries during demand spikes.
  • Secure flexible financing: Revenue-based options like Onramp Funds let you repay based on sales, easing cash flow during slow periods.
  • Monitor in real time: Set up dashboards to track demand, inventory, and fulfillment metrics for quick decision-making.
  • Refine processes post-peak: Review performance, adjust forecasts, and improve supplier and fulfillment strategies.

Managing demand swings requires preparation, flexibility, and the right tools. Stay proactive to keep your business running smoothly during both highs and lows.

8-Step Checklist for Managing eCommerce Demand Fluctuations

8-Step Checklist for Managing eCommerce Demand Fluctuations

How Do Businesses Plan for Demand Fluctuations?

Assess Demand Patterns and Volatility

To handle shifting demand effectively, start by diving into your sales history. Analyze data from platforms like Amazon, Shopify, or Walmart Marketplace to identify when your sales hit peaks and when they slow down.

Map Seasonal and Event-Driven Demand

Look at your sales reports to spot patterns during key shopping events. Big dates like Black Friday, Cyber Monday, and the holiday season from Thanksgiving to Christmas often bring a 30–50% boost in sales compared to your usual numbers [3][4]. Back-to-school shopping in August and September, as well as events like Prime Day, also tend to create significant spikes.

But it’s not just the calendar driving demand. External factors like shipping deadlines, weather disruptions (think snowstorms pushing holiday buying earlier), competitor promotions, or even shifts in economic sentiment can move demand up or down by 10–20% [3]. Track these variables alongside your year-over-year revenue trends to pinpoint where they align with major sales shifts. This will give you a clearer picture of when and why demand fluctuates.

These insights will help you decide which products need closer attention and strategic planning.

Segment Products by Demand and Margin

Not every product in your catalog deserves the same level of focus. Use an ABC analysis to break down your inventory.

  • A-items: These are your top performers - usually 20% of your SKUs that drive 80% of your revenue.
  • B-items: These sit in the middle range, contributing moderately to sales.
  • C-items: The lower performers that bring in the least revenue.

To understand how demand fluctuates for each product, calculate the standard deviation of monthly sales. This will help you identify which items are the most unpredictable [5][6]. For instance, if you sell clothing, winter coats might be A-items with around 40% volatility during the holiday season. Focus your forecasting and stock strategies on these high-margin, high-volatility products, as they can have the biggest impact on your bottom line.

This segmentation sets the stage for building demand scenarios.

Establish Demand Scenarios

Plan for different demand outcomes by developing three scenarios:

  • Base scenario: Your expected demand (100%).
  • Upside scenario: A surge, such as a 30% increase.
  • Downside scenario: A drop, like a 20% decrease [3][7].

Model how each scenario would affect your inventory and cash flow. For example, if a surge requires doubling your stock, make sure to arrange financing ahead of time. Flexible, revenue-based financing options - such as Onramp Funds - can be particularly helpful. They allow you to adjust repayments based on sales, avoiding fixed payments during slower periods.

Build Flexible Supply and Fulfillment Capacity

After mapping out your demand scenarios, the next crucial step is ensuring your supply chain can handle those fluctuations. A rigid supply chain can crumble under the pressure of a sudden viral sales surge or a supplier delay during the busy season. Transitioning from demand analysis, it's time to focus on making your supply chain adaptable to these challenges.

Diversify Critical Suppliers

For high-demand items, having 2–3 suppliers lined up is a smart way to reduce the risk of disruptions. This doesn't mean splitting your orders equally among them - it’s about having reliable backups ready to step in when needed [8].

Start by identifying potential suppliers using platforms like ThomasNet or Alibaba. Evaluate them based on lead times, scalability, quality, and location. Diversifying suppliers across different regions can shield you from localized issues like port delays or extreme weather events [2][8]. Before committing to large orders, place smaller test orders - about 20–30% of your usual volume - to gauge their reliability. Negotiate flexible contracts that let you adjust order quantities without penalties, so you're ready to scale up quickly during demand spikes [8].

Shorten and Document Lead Times

Once you've diversified your suppliers, focus on cutting down delays. Map your supply chain to identify bottlenecks, whether they occur during production, shipping, or customs clearance. Tools like ShipBob, Flexport, or NetSuite can help you monitor actual delivery times against what was promised [2][5].

Set clear service level agreements (SLAs) with your suppliers, aiming for lead times under 30 days for key items. Track metrics like order-to-ship time, supplier fill rate (target above 95%), and on-time delivery rates [8][3]. If delays keep cropping up, address them directly - renegotiate terms, switch to faster shipping options, or look for alternative suppliers. By adopting agile practices, you can potentially cut lead times in half, making your supply chain more responsive [2][5].

Prepare Alternative Fulfillment Paths

With diverse suppliers and shorter lead times in place, the next step is to ensure your fulfillment process stays resilient. Pre-qualify 2–3 third-party logistics (3PL) providers and explore marketplace fulfillment options like FBA (Fulfillment by Amazon) or Walmart Fulfillment Services. Splitting inventory across multiple locations creates redundancy - if one center faces delays or disruptions, you can reroute orders to another [3].

Test these backup options during slower periods by routing 10–30% of orders through secondary fulfillment paths. This allows you to confirm their systems work smoothly, inventory stays synced, and they can handle scaling up when demand spikes [3]. During busy seasons or viral sales events, use real-time sales data to dynamically reallocate inventory. For instance, one clothing retailer successfully managed double their usual holiday volume by combining FBA with a secondary 3PL, maintaining a 98% on-time delivery rate without running out of stock [8][3].

Align Inventory and Financing with Demand Shifts

Once you've built a flexible supply chain, the next step is ensuring your inventory and financing are aligned with fluctuating demand. Having the right stock levels and the proper funding at the right time is essential. If inventory and financing don't match, you risk either tying up too much capital or facing stockouts - both of which can hurt your bottom line.

Set Safety Stock Levels by SKU Volatility

To maintain the right inventory levels, calculate safety stock for each SKU based on its volatility. This involves factoring in average daily demand, demand variability (measured by the standard deviation of sales), and supplier lead times. For high-priority products, aim for a service level of 90–95%, which corresponds to a Z-score between 1.28 and 1.65. A simple formula for stable lead times is:
Safety Stock ≈ Z × standard deviation of daily demand × √lead time in days [5][6].

Segment your product catalog by both demand volatility and gross margin. High-margin, volatile SKUs should have higher safety stock levels because their profitability makes stockouts particularly costly [5][6]. On the other hand, low-margin, low-volatility items can carry minimal buffers to avoid tying up unnecessary cash [6].

Once you’ve determined the right inventory levels, you’ll need to secure the funding to maintain them.

Secure Non-Dilutive Financing Options

Even with well-optimized inventory, you might still need external funding to cover purchase orders, especially when suppliers require deposits or freight costs need to be paid upfront. Traditional loans can be slow and inflexible, so consider revenue-based financing instead. This approach provides a lump sum for inventory or marketing, with repayment tied to sales rather than fixed monthly payments [4].

Onramp Funds is a key player in this space, offering fast, equity-free financing specifically for eCommerce sellers. They work with platforms like Amazon, Shopify, BigCommerce, WooCommerce, Squarespace, Walmart Marketplace, and TikTok Shop. By analyzing your store’s sales history and trends, Onramp Funds can approve funding - often within 24 hours - so you can quickly respond to demand surges or time-sensitive inventory opportunities.

Align Repayment Structures with Sales Performance

Fixed repayment loans can create cash flow challenges during slow sales periods. Revenue-based financing solves this by adjusting repayments according to actual sales. When demand is high, you pay more; during slower months, payments automatically decrease [4]. This flexibility helps protect your cash flow, allowing you to cover operating expenses, logistics costs, and future purchase orders, even during off-peak times like January or February.

Onramp Funds’ repayment model is based on a fixed percentage of daily or weekly sales, ensuring that your financial obligations align naturally with revenue. This structure is particularly useful for U.S. sellers managing unpredictable demand around major retail events.

Monitor in Real Time and Adjust Quickly

To stay ahead in eCommerce, real-time monitoring is essential for making quick, tactical decisions. Without up-to-date insights, inventory and financing strategies can fall flat. Unfortunately, many U.S. eCommerce sellers only check their dashboards once a day - or even once a week - missing critical shifts in demand until it’s too late. When demand changes rapidly, you need real-time visibility and the ability to act within minutes.

Build Real-Time Dashboards

A strong dashboard is your command center, updating every 15–60 minutes. During peak periods, aim for daily formal reviews and mid-day checks. Organize your dashboard into three key panels:

  • Demand: Track live orders, average order value, channel mix, and promo performance.
  • Supply/Inventory: Monitor units on hand, inbound shipments, days of cover, and at-risk SKUs.
  • Fulfillment/Service: Keep an eye on pick/pack times, carrier scan rates, on-time shipments, and unshipped orders.

Use color-coded alerts to quickly identify issues - red for days of cover below 5, yellow for 5–10. With this setup, you can act fast, whether it’s pausing ads, adjusting pricing, or prioritizing certain SKUs.

If you’re worried about needing a large engineering team to connect various platforms and 3PLs, don’t be. Off-the-shelf BI tools with native connectors for platforms like Amazon, Shopify, BigCommerce, and major fulfillment centers can automate data syncing every hour. Start simple: export key reports daily, then transition to automated API feeds. Standardize SKU IDs across channels to avoid mismatches, and you’ll have a streamlined, code-free dashboard that keeps your team on the same page.

With real-time data at your fingertips, you’ll be ready to adjust pricing and promotions to manage demand effectively.

Use Pricing and Promotion Levers

When order velocity spikes or days of cover drop below 5, act immediately. To slow demand during stock shortages, consider raising prices on constrained SKUs by 5–10%, removing coupon codes, lowering ad budgets, or redirecting traffic to alternative products. On the flip side, if you have excess inventory - over 60 days of cover and sell-through below target - use strategies to boost demand. These could include limited-time discounts, targeted email or SMS campaigns to past buyers, free shipping thresholds, bundling slow-moving items, or increasing ad spend on high-margin SKUs.

Set clear pricing boundaries to protect your margins and avoid customer frustration. Transparent communication, such as time-limited sales or “limited stock” messaging, can help manage customer expectations even when prices fluctuate.

Monitor Financing Utilization

Your dashboards shouldn’t just track inventory - they should also give you insights into financing. Keep tabs on metrics like funds drawn, cash allocation, inventory turnover, and sales-based repayment. For revenue-based financing solutions like Onramp Funds, it’s especially important to see how daily remittances align with cash flow needs for restocking during busy or slower periods. A simple financing panel should include:

  • Current outstanding balance
  • Trailing 7- and 30-day repayments
  • Projected payback dates under various sales scenarios

Review Performance and Refine Plans

Once the peak period wraps up, it’s time to reflect. Within 1–2 weeks, gather your cross-functional teams for a retrospective. This is your chance to identify what worked, what didn’t, and how to improve for the next cycle. Peak periods often reveal operational weaknesses that aren’t obvious during normal times, so use these insights to make meaningful adjustments.

Analyze Forecast vs. Actual Performance

Start by breaking down forecasted units and revenue versus actual results. Look at this data by SKU, category, sales channel, and week. Use metrics like Mean Absolute Percentage Error (MAPE) and forecast bias to measure how accurate your forecasts were and identify patterns of over- or under-forecasting. Pay special attention to your top SKUs by revenue and margin, as gaps here can have the biggest impact.

Organize forecast errors into two categories: over-forecasting (leading to excess stock, markdowns, and locked-up cash) and under-forecasting (causing stockouts, lost sales, and missed ad opportunities). Dig deeper to find the root causes of these gaps. Was it a surprise spike in campaign performance? Pricing changes? Competitor moves? Or external factors like weather or shipping delays? Use these insights to refine your forecasting models, factor in promotional variables, and improve coordination between marketing plans and inventory purchases. These adjustments will also help you evaluate suppliers and fine-tune processes for the next season.

Evaluate Supplier and Fulfillment Performance

Building on your forecasting analysis, assess how well your suppliers performed. Track key metrics like on-time-in-full (OTIF) rate, actual versus contracted lead times, and their ability to handle expedited orders or last-minute changes. Also, review any quality issues, defect rates, and returns tied to specific suppliers. Categorize your suppliers into three groups: strategic partners to invest in, reliable but improvable partners, and those that may need to be replaced due to recurring delays or quality problems.

Next, evaluate fulfillment operations. Look at metrics like order cycle time (from order placement to delivery), on-time shipment rates, and error rates such as incorrect orders. Pinpoint where bottlenecks occurred - whether in receiving, picking, packing, or carrier pickup - and assess how quickly delays were communicated to your team and customers. Based on this analysis, decide if you need process upgrades, new tech investments (like a warehouse management system), or additional or alternative 3PLs for specific regions or product lines.

Update Policies and Plans

Take everything you’ve learned and apply it to your policies and plans. Adjust safety stock levels based on actual demand variability and supplier reliability. For high-margin, high-demand SKUs, increase safety stock and consider earlier order cutoffs. For lower-margin or slower-moving items, scale back stock levels and tighten reorder points to conserve cash. Reclassify your SKUs so that critical items are monitored more closely and managed with more conservative policies during future peaks.

Revise your demand planning playbook and supplier scorecards accordingly. After the peak, map out cash flow - inventory purchases, marketing spend, fulfillment surcharges, sales revenue, returns, and fees - to identify where working capital was stretched thin. For the next cycle, consider aligning inventory financing with demand using revenue-based models like Onramp Funds, which adjust repayments based on sales performance. This approach minimizes the risk of overextending during slower periods. Finally, document all lessons learned to continuously refine your demand planning and financing strategies.

Conclusion

Handling demand fluctuations effectively requires systems that can adapt swiftly to market changes. The checklist above offers a structured approach: identify your demand patterns, introduce flexibility into your supply chain, align inventory and financing with actual sales cycles, keep a close eye on real-time data, and use each peak as a learning opportunity to refine your process. This approach ties together demand analysis, agile supply chain management, and financing strategies that adjust to changing conditions. Each step emphasizes the importance of staying as responsive as the market itself.

Even with accurate forecasts and strong supplier relationships, missing the ability to fund inventory or scale marketing during demand spikes can mean lost opportunities. Flexible, sales-adjusted repayments can help maintain cash flow during uncertain times, avoiding the strain of fixed payment schedules.

In this context, Onramp Funds offers a practical solution by providing fast, equity-free capital with repayments that scale automatically with sales. Designed for eCommerce sellers on platforms like Amazon, Shopify, Walmart Marketplace, and TikTok Shop, Onramp often approves funding in as little as 24 hours.

"Onramp offered the perfect solution with revenue-based financing to secure the capital we needed to invest in inventory and pay it back at a reasonable time frame once we made sales." - Jeremy, Founder and Owner of Kindfolk Yoga [1]

FAQs

What are the best ways to predict demand changes for my eCommerce business?

To get a handle on demand changes, dive into your sales data to spot patterns and trends. Look for things like seasonal shifts, holiday impacts, or broader market conditions that might influence your numbers.

You can also use tools that analyze your sales history and cash flow. They’ll give you a clearer picture of potential demand swings, allowing you to make smarter inventory decisions. By staying ahead of these changes, you’ll be ready to handle both unexpected surges and quieter times with ease.

How can I make my supply chain more resilient to demand fluctuations?

Building a stronger, more adaptable supply chain starts with broadening your supplier base. Relying on just one source can leave you vulnerable, so working with vendors across various regions can help you avoid issues like shipping delays or local disruptions. Another key strategy is keeping a safety stock - this extra inventory acts as a buffer to meet sudden spikes in demand. Lastly, think about using flexible financing options, such as revenue-based funding, to quickly scale your inventory when circumstances require it. These steps can make it easier to handle seasonal fluctuations and unexpected changes in demand.

How can revenue-based financing help manage cash flow during demand changes?

Revenue-based financing offers a practical way to manage cash flow by tying repayment amounts directly to your sales performance. When sales slow down, your payments shrink, giving you some breathing room financially. On the flip side, when sales pick up, repayments increase proportionally. This approach helps you keep operations running smoothly and supports growth efforts, even when demand fluctuates unexpectedly.

Related Blog Posts